Transaction 54e190c3a5c36c4989dbd5d7daf139869420e6423f0396c8ad991fd38c5db8f6
1 Input
1 Output
-
54e190c3a5c36c4989dbd5d7daf139869420e6423f0396c8ad991fd38c5db8f6:0
- value
- 597498
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e621cf8da40884e501817063e7d253adbe1960bc OP_EQUAL
- address
- 3Nfqqsq8brim5uy7J43RqhAJE6oZQjrqQj